Microsoft has confirmed that Data Loss Prevention file policy capabilities in Microsoft Defender for Cloud Apps are deprecated effective January 6, 2027. The capabilities move to Microsoft Purview, and Microsoft has indicated an automated migration tool will follow.
Five months is a comfortable runway for a migration that is genuinely mechanical. This one is not, and the gap between "a tool exists" and "the policies work" is where organizations lose control of their data protection posture.
Why the tool will not be enough
A DLP file policy is not configuration. It is a business rule expressed in configuration — a statement about which data matters, who may hold it, where it may travel and what happens when it does not. Those rules were written at a particular moment, usually by someone responding to a particular incident or audit finding, and in most organizations they have never been reviewed since.
A migration tool will translate the mechanics. It will not tell you that the policy scoped to a SharePoint site collection is now scoped to a site that no longer exists, that the file type list predates the organization's move to a different document format, that the notification address belongs to a person who left in 2023, or that three overlapping policies produce contradictory outcomes on the same file. Migration is the moment those problems surface, and it is far better to surface them deliberately than to discover them when a policy fails silently in production.
The migration sequence that works
Inventory first. Export every DLP file policy from Defender for Cloud Apps with its scope, conditions, actions, notification targets and — critically — its firing history over the last ninety days. That last column is the most informative one in the whole exercise. Policies that have never fired are either perfectly preventive or entirely miscalibrated, and the difference matters.
Classify by intent. Group the policies by the business rule they encode rather than by their technical configuration. Several policies frequently express the same underlying rule through different mechanisms, accumulated as different people addressed the same concern. Consolidating at this stage produces a smaller, more maintainable estate in Purview than a one-to-one translation would.
Validate against current reality. For each rule, confirm the scope still exists, the data classification still reflects how the organization handles that data, the action is still proportionate, and the notification reaches someone. This is the step that requires business input rather than platform work, which means it is the step that determines the timeline. Start it early.
Build in Purview and run parallel. Purview's DLP model is more capable and differently structured — it has a stronger relationship to sensitivity labels, broader coverage across endpoints and services, and a different policy evaluation order. Build the policies in Purview in audit mode, run them alongside the existing Defender for Cloud Apps policies, and compare outcomes for at least a full business cycle before enforcing. Discrepancies are informative in both directions.
Cut over, then decommission. Enforce in Purview, monitor, and only then retire the Defender for Cloud Apps policies. Do not decommission on the strength of a successful build.
The opportunity inside the deprecation
Purview's DLP is the better platform, and the migration is a forced opportunity to move to it properly rather than to replicate an older configuration inside it. The integration with sensitivity labels in particular allows policy to key off a label applied at creation rather than off content inspection at every evaluation, which is both more accurate and less expensive. Organizations that have deployed labels but never connected them to DLP enforcement can close that gap as part of this work.
There is also a licensing dimension worth checking. The 2026 packaging update moves additional Purview capability into the suites and introduces a Purview Suite bundle at 12.00 USD per user per month. Confirm what your current entitlement covers before scoping the target state, because organizations frequently discover during this exercise that they already own more of Purview than they are using.
